My laptop used to connect to the wireless connection , but one day it stopped working and now i can only connect to internet using a lan cable

go into the device manager and uninstall the wireless adapter. Then click scan for hardware changes and let windows resinstall it. It sounds like a corrupt driver. Before doing so make sure you didnt hit the wireless button that shuts off the connection on the computer. :)
